#c31c18 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c31c18 is composed of 76.5% red, 11%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.6% magenta, 87.7%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 1.4 degrees, a saturation of 78.1% and a lightness of 42.9%. #c31c18 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3830 with #870000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#c31c18 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c31c18 has RGB values of R:195, G:28,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.86, Y:0.88,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12786712.

Shades and Tints of #c31c18
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030000 is the darkest color, while #fdf1f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c31c18
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f6c6c is the less saturated color, while #d40c07 is the most saturated one.
